I was thrilled when I read about the upcoming release of DPP 3.0. Finally it's here and I installed it. I processed several sets of photos through it and quite frankly, I think Canon rushed it out the door. It's pretty buggy. Here is what I don't like about the new features:
1.) When double clicking on a thumbnail for editiong, the editing tool palatte floats, there is no way to make it dock.
2.) Not only are my preview thumbnails extremely blurry, but when I double click one one, SOMETIMES the enlarged image is pixelated. The only way to get rid of the pixilization is to double click on the image again enlarging it to 100%, then double clicking again to reduce the size.
3.) It's nice that they added a NR tab to choose NR for an individual image, but now there is no was to apply NR to all images simultaneously, other than using a recipe. I prefer a global option that can be toggled on or off.
I uninstalled 3.0 and re-installed 2.2. Maybe Canon can get it right with 3.1
